#ifndef PHONON_MEDIAOBJECT_H
#define PHONON_MEDIAOBJECT_H

#include <phonon/mediaobjectinterface.h>
#include <phonon/addoninterface.h>

#include <QtCore/QHash>
#include <QtCore/QObject>
#include <QtCore/QQueue>
#include <QtCore/QBasicTimer>
#include <QtCore/QMutex>
#include <QtCore/QThread>

#include "backendnode.h"
#include "mediagraph.h"

QT_BEGIN_NAMESPACE

namespace Phonon
{
    class MediaSource;

    namespace DS9
    {
        class VideoWidget;
        class AudioOutput;

        class QWinWaitCondition
        {
        public:
            QWinWaitCondition() : m_handle(::CreateEvent(0,0,0,0))
            {
            }

            ~QWinWaitCondition()
            {
                ::CloseHandle(m_handle);
            }

            void reset()
            {
                //will block
                ::ResetEvent(m_handle);
            }

            void set()
            {
                //will unblock
                ::SetEvent(m_handle);
            }

            operator HANDLE()
            {
                return m_handle;
            }

            operator HEVENT()
            {
                return reinterpret_cast<HEVENT>(m_handle);
            }


        private:
            HANDLE m_handle;
        };

        class WorkerThread : public QThread
        {
            Q_OBJECT
        public:
            WorkerThread();
            ~WorkerThread();

            virtual void run();

            //wants to know as soon as the state is set
            void addStateChangeRequest(Graph graph, OAFilterState, QList<Filter> = QList<Filter>());

            quint16 addSeekRequest(Graph graph, qint64 time);
            quint16 addUrlToRender(const QString &url);
            quint16 addFilterToRender(const Filter &filter);

            void replaceGraphForEventManagement(Graph newGraph, Graph oldGraph);

    		void abortCurrentRender(qint16 renderId);

            //tells the thread to stop processing
            void signalStop();

        Q_SIGNALS:
            void asyncRenderFinished(quint16, HRESULT, Graph);
            void asyncSeekingFinished(quint16, qint64);
            void stateReady(Graph, Phonon::State);
            void eventReady(Graph, long eventCode, long param1);

        private:

            enum Task
            {
                None,
                Render,
                Seek,
                ChangeState,
                ReplaceGraph //just updates recalls WaitForMultipleObject
            };

            struct Work
            {
                Work() : task(None), id(0), time(0) { }
                Task task;
                quint16 id;
                Graph graph;
                Graph oldGraph;
                Filter filter;
                QString url;
                union
                {
                    qint64 time;
                    OAFilterState state;
                };
                QList<Filter> decoders; //for the state change requests
            };
            void handleTask();

            Work m_currentWork;
            QQueue<Work> m_queue;
            bool m_finished;
            quint16 m_currentWorkId;
            QWinWaitCondition m_waitCondition;
            QMutex m_mutex; // mutex for the m_queue, m_finished and m_currentWorkId

            //this is for WaitForMultipleObjects
            struct
            {
                Graph graph;
                HANDLE handle;
            } m_graphHandle[FILTER_COUNT];
        };
